Why Concrete Paints Fail Too Soon

Concrete is tougher than most surfaces, but it’s also alive in a way; it expands, contracts and breathes moisture. These natural movements are the leading causes of paint failure.

Here are the top reasons concrete coatings don’t hold up over time.

  • Moisture Migration: Water vapour rising from below the slab lifts the coating, creating bubbles or peeling.
  • UV Exposure: Regular paint chalks and fades in sunlight.
  • Improper Curing: Walking or driving on a floor before it’s fully cured weakens the bond.
  • Low-Quality Paint: Off-the-shelf paints often lack the solids content and bonding agents needed for concrete surfaces.

Each of the above issues has one thing in common, and that can be avoided through choosing the right professional-grade product and following the correct application steps.

Steps to a Long-Lasting Finish

Even the most durable concrete paint depends on proper prep and care. Follow these five golden rules to keep your floor or patio looking pristine for years.

1: Test for Moisture: Use a simple plastic sheet test to check for vapour movement through the slab. If moisture is present, apply ArmorPoxy Moisture Barrier Primer first to lock it out.

2: Deep Clean and Etch: concrete needs a clean, open surface to grip the paint. Etching removes laitance and opens up the pores. ArmorPoxy’s Etching Solution ensures perfect adhesion.

3: Use Two Coats – Not One: A thin, single coat of paint can wear quickly. Two coats create the right film thickness to handle heavy use.

4: Add a Clear Topcoat: For areas exposed to UV sun, vehicles or spills, add a urethane or polyaspartic topcoat. It seals colour, resists UV rays and adds a glossy, easy-to-clean finish.

5: Maintain Regularly: Sweep or mop or wash as needed. We should avoid acidic cleaners and harsh scrubbing pads that can dull the coating.

Pro-Tip: Recoat Before It’s Too Late

A common mistake is waiting until the coating completely fails before recoating. The best time to refresh your floor is when it starts to lose gloss or show mild wear, not when it is already peeling.

A quick recoat is maintenance after every few years that dramatically extends the life of the system – a small effort for long-term savings.
